精通语言核心:函数变量高阶运用技巧深度剖析
发布时间:2026-03-18 10:15:29 所属栏目:语言 来源:DaWei
导读: 函数变量是编程中的核心概念,理解其高阶用法能显著提升代码的灵活性和可维护性。在许多语言中,函数可以作为变量传递,甚至作为参数或返回值,这种特性使得函数成为一等公民。 高阶函数是处理函数变量的一种
|
函数变量是编程中的核心概念,理解其高阶用法能显著提升代码的灵活性和可维护性。在许多语言中,函数可以作为变量传递,甚至作为参数或返回值,这种特性使得函数成为一等公民。 高阶函数是处理函数变量的一种常见方式,例如map、filter和reduce等,它们接受函数作为输入并返回新的数据结构。这种模式让开发者能够以声明式的方式编写简洁的逻辑。
2026AI模拟图,仅供参考 闭包是另一个重要概念,它允许函数访问并记住其词法作用域。通过闭包,可以在函数内部创建私有变量,实现更复杂的封装和状态管理。函数变量还可以用于实现回调、事件处理和异步操作。例如,在JavaScript中,将函数作为参数传递给其他函数,可以实现非阻塞的执行流程。 掌握这些技巧不仅有助于写出更高效的代码,还能提高代码的可读性和可扩展性。理解函数变量的本质,是迈向高级编程的关键一步。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|
推荐文章
站长推荐

